Ann Newnes

 

Ann Newnes was Solihull Healing Group’s senior probationar healer for many years. After completing her NFSH healer training, she dedicated her healing path to those who came to Solihull Healing Group with many different difficulties. Ann was a good listener and cared for all those she gave healing to in the many different venues the Group visited.

 

Ann lived in Balsall Common. She hoped to set up a satellite healing centre in her village, but unfortunately the village hall had other commitments. In her last years, Ann was incapacitated by ill health and was unable to continue healing, but always sent her best wishes to the rest of the group. Ann died in early 2007, but her fellow healers remember her with great fondness.

Philip Crocker

It is with great sadness we announce the death of Philip Crocker, one of the founder members of Solihull Healing Group, who died suddenly in August at the age of 57.

Sarah Head writes:

Phil was the first person I met when I joined Solihull Healing Group in 1999. I knew nothing about healing then, only that I wanted to learn what it entailed. Phil told me about his training and how he performed the healing act. He made me feel very welcome and keen to pursue formal qualifications.

Later I came to know Phil as the joyful person he was – always full of smiles and enthusiasm for whatever was going on. I valued his healing ability and would often seek him out to give me healing when I was feeling particularly stressed or in need. He was unfailingly gentle and unstinting with his gifts. I shall always remember the personal messages he offered me and the great love with which they were presented.

To me, Phil was a person who saw good in everything, making the best of often difficult situations. I know how deeply he cared about issues which touched him most and he had the ability to feel and respond wherever he found himself, be it playing with a severely ill toddler or walking in the countryside. He was always willing to help out with whatever was needed and gave of himself and his time with overwhelming generosity. He loved offering healing to people who had never received it before and often helped with both local and regional healing events.

To say we will miss Phil, is a total understatement. He was an integral part of Solihull Healing Group both as a healer and as our treasurer. We shall keep expecting his presence, his smiles, his jokes and his laughter to be with us and although their absence will bring sadness, their memory will also bring a smile.
